Nine-Second TripeNine-second kidney is a dish primarily made with pig kidneys. The kidney slices are marinated with cooking wine, starch, and other seasonings, then quickly blanched in boiling water for about nine seconds until cooked through. They are then stir-fried with ingredients such as scallions, ginger, garlic, and chili peppers. The finished dish features tender, smooth kidney slices with a rich and satisfying texture.

Sour Spicy Tofu NoodlesSpicy and sour rice tofu is a dish made with rice tofu as the main ingredient, seasoned with chili, vinegar, garlic, and ginger. Rice tofu is soft and tender, made by steaming rice paste. It's cut into cubes, stir-fried with sautéed chili, garlic, and ginger, then seasoned with vinegar and salt, finally thickened with a cornstarch slurry.
